Your mentor
As a Executive Producer with more than a two decades of experience in AAA game development, I’ve spent the last 20 years growing from journalism into production leadership roles across studios like Remedy, MachineGames, PUBG/Krafton, and Sumo Digital.
I’ve led teams across multiple projects and locations, supported senior producers, and helped studios navigate periods of growth and change — especially when moving from single‑project setups to more complex, multi‑project environments.
I typically get involved when things need more clarity: aligning teams, improving collaboration, and helping people deliver ambitious work in a sustainable way.
In these sessions, I can support you with:
-Career growth in games (especially production, leadership, or transitioning into leadership roles)
-Navigating team dynamics and stakeholder alignment
-Preparing for interviews and senior roles
-Thinking through real production challenges in a practical, grounded way
-Making pitch decks for publishers, investors
-Getting funding for your startup
I usually keep sessions conversational and focused on your situation — whether you’re preparing for something specific or just want a sounding board.
